Our mission and vision:

The Furniture Bank of Central Ohio provides free furniture to our central Ohio neighbors in need.

 

Our vision is that some day ALL central Ohio families will live in properly furnished homes as a result of furniture resource sharing and community collaborations.

 

History:

In 1998, Jeff Hay founded the Furniture Bank as Material Assistance Providers. Over the years, and under the current leadership of Jim Stein, the Furniture Bank has grown to become a collaborative community project. FBCO has increased furniture donation volume via aggressive community awareness campaigns and directed marketing efforts, strengthened the quality and consistency of its service to families in need and the agencies who refer them, and increased its facility space by moving to a permanent facility in Franklinton (just west of downtown Columbus).    

 

With a dedicated paid and volunteer staff in place, and with the guidance of its Board of Directors, the Furniture Bank has grown from the humble beginnings in 1998 of serving only a few hundred families per year, to serving nearly 3,800 in 2009. It is now the second largest furniture bank in the nation.

 

Moving into 2010 with a new name, new branding, new website and new ideas, the Furniture Bank of Central Ohio continues to grow forward, increase community collaboration and increase self-sustainability in pursuit of its simple mission and long-term vision of seeing EVERY family in central Ohio living in a properly-furnished home.
